PROCEDURE

实验过程

4-(Methoxycarbonyl)-3-nitrobenzoic acid (100 g, 0.44 mol) was taken into concentrated aqueous ammonia (37w %, 500 mL), and the resulting yellow solution was allowed to stir at room temperature over 12 hours. The solution was then reduced in volume to approximately 300 mL by rotary evaporation, and the solution was acidified to pH 2 by portion-wise addition of concentrated aqueous hydrochloric acid. The thick precipitate was collected by filtration and dried in vacuo to afford 4-(aminocarbonyl)-3-nitrobenzoic acid (51 g, 60% yield). 1H-NMR (d6-DMSO): 8.42 (d, 1H), 8.27 (dd, 1H), 8.26 (br s, 1H), 7.86 (br s, 1H), 7.76 (d, 1H).
